    My favourite movie tie-in, which I recently started playing again, is Scarface: The World is Yours.
    Basically GTA with an 80s Miami twist and lots of swearing in foreign languages.
    Has an awesome soundtrack too.
    Definately worth a look if you like Scarface the movie. :)

    Tron 2.0 was a sleeper, had so much fun back in the day too

    Trying to escape the disk format as it engulfed the entire level, as you tried to jump to a new partition was especially inspired... as was trying to download abilities as you were being attacked and cursing your slow download speeds :D
